Megan Gorrey is the Sydney editor at The Sydney Morning Herald. She specializes in urban affairs, focusing on themes such as urban design, development, and the housing market, while also exploring the intersections of culture and society within these topics. Megan's work has been featured in The Age, Brisbane Times, WAtoday, and Stuff.
